What is function notation?

Back

Function notation is a way to represent a function using symbols, typically written as f(x), where 'f' is the name of the function and 'x' is the input variable.

How do you evaluate a function at a specific point?

Back

To evaluate a function at a specific point, substitute the value of the input variable into the function's equation and simplify.

Given f(x) = 2x + 1, find f(4).

Back

f(4) = 2(4) + 1 = 8 + 1 = 9.

If f(x) = 2x + 1, what is x when f(x) = 16?

Back

Set 2x + 1 = 16, then solve for x: 2x = 15, x = 15/2.
